Group Procurement Specialist

Mantrac Group · Sharkia, Egypt · Posted 2026-08-06

Job PurposeThe Group Procurement Specialist is responsible for supporting and managing end-to-end Procurement Operations activities across the organization, including Procure-to-Pay (P2P), Supplier Management, Procurement Systems Administration, Reporting, and Process Improvement.The role ensures procurement activities are executed efficiently, accurately, and in compliance with company policies, governance standards, and internal control requirements.A key focus of this role during the initial phase will be supporting the organization's ongoing Oracle ERP implementation project. The successful candidate will work closely with the Oracle project team, Procurement, Finance, IT, and business stakeholders to support system implementation, process mapping, testing, data validation, user training, change management, and post-go-live activities. Therefore, solid Oracle ERP experience and implementation exposure are mandatory requirements for this role.Key ResponsibilitiesOracle ERP Implementation SupportAct as a Procurement Subject Matter Expert (SME) for Oracle ERP Procurement processes.Support Oracle ERP implementation, testing, deployment, and adoption activities.Participate in requirements gathering, business process mapping, SIT/UAT testing, data validation, training, and go-live support.Work closely with implementation partners, IT teams, and business stakeholders to ensure successful project delivery.Support change management and post-go-live activities to ensure smooth transition and user adoption.Procurement Operations & P2P ManagementManage Procure-to-Pay (P2P) activities, including converting Purchase Requisitions into Purchase Orders.Ensure procurement transactions comply with approved policies, procedures, Delegation of Authority (DOA), and internal control requirements.Process Requests for Quotations (RFQs) and support sourcing activities as required.Coordinate with suppliers and internal stakeholders to ensure accurate pricing, lead times, and order execution.Support urgent and special procurement requirements in accordance with procurement policies and standards.Supplier ManagementSupport supplier onboarding, registration, pre-qualification, and documentation processes.Maintain supplier master data and approved supplier records.Monitor supplier performance and support supplier risk assessment activities.Act as the first point of contact for supplier-related procurement queries and issue resolution.Order Management & Invoice ResolutionManage Purchase Order administration, amendments, confirmations, and procurement documentation.Monitor open orders and follow up on delayed deliveries, pricing discrepancies, and outstanding commitments.Support the resolution of blocked invoices, GR/IR variances, and procurement-related payment issues.Work closely with Finance and Accounts Payable teams to ensure timely supplier payments.Procurement Systems & Process ImprovementAct as a key user and administrator of procurement systems and workflows.Manage procurement master data, contracts, purchasing records, and related system activities.Provide system support, guidance, and training to business users.Support procurement process improvement initiatives to enhance efficiency, compliance, and user experience.Contribute to procurement transformation and continuous improvement projects.Reporting & GovernancePrepare and maintain procurement reports, dashboards, and performance metrics.Monitor procurement compliance, purchasing controls, and audit requirements.Support internal and external audits related to procurement activities.Track claims, credits, returns, and corrective actions to ensure timely resolution.Job SpecificationEducationBachelor's Degree in Business Administration, Supply Chain Management, Procurement, Finance, Information Systems, or a related field.Experience & Professional BackgroundMinimum 2-3 years of experience in Procurement Operations, Procure-to-Pay (P2P), Supplier Management, Procurement Systems, or a related field.Good understanding of procurement processes, supplier management, purchasing controls, and compliance requirements.Experience working with Procurement, Finance, Accounts Payable, and cross-functional business teams.Strong analytical, reporting, communication, and problem-solving skills.Oracle ERP Experience (Mandatory)Solid hands-on experience with Oracle ERP Procurement modules is mandatory.Candidates must have participated in at least one Oracle ERP implementation, migration, upgrade, or transformation project.Experience supporting implementation activities including business requirements gathering, process mapping, testing (SIT/UAT), data validation, training, go-live, and post-go-live support.Experience working directly with Oracle implementation partners, IT teams, and business stakeholders throughout the project lifecycle.Strong understanding of Oracle Procurement, Purchasing, Supplier Management, Contracts, and Master Data Management processes.Ability to support procurement system enhancements and digital transformation initiatives.Technical SkillsStrong proficiency in Oracle ERP Procurement solutions.Advanced Microsoft Excel and reporting skills.Experience in procurement master data management and workflow administration.Understanding of procurement system integrations with Finance and Accounts Payable functions.

About Mantrac Group

Machinery Manufacturing

Mantrac Group is the authorized dealer of Caterpillar machinery, engines, and power systems across multiple African countries including Egypt. The company supplies and services construction, mining, and power generation equipment to industrial customers.
